Sm3+ Activated Potassium Magnesium Pyrophosphate Nanophosphor: Synthesis, Structure, Optical and Luminescence Studies
摘要
K2Mg(1-x)P2O7Smx (x = 0.5–5 mol%) pyrophosphates were synthesized using a self-propagating solution combustion approach with the objective of generating luminous material for applications involving white light-emitting diodes. The structure formation of single-phase phosphor is validated, by the XRD and the presence of pyrophosphate (P2O7)4- group is validated, by the FTIR. The HRTEM and XPS validates the morphological and electronic studies of the synthesized nanophosphor, respectively.
